Scottish Rite Awards Grant to Center For SiouxlandNovember 10, 2009George Harrison representing the Sioux City Scottish Rite made a check presentation to Center For Siouxland’s Board of Directors on Tuesday, Nov. 10 at noon at Center For Siouxland located at 715 Douglas St. Scottish Rite awarded Center For Siouxland $1,200 to be used for installing automatic door openers for the agency’s front doors.
Russ Wermers, Board Chair, states, “We are truly thankful to the Scottish Rite for helping cover the financing of this project and without their donation we could not undertake such an improvement to our facility.” The cost to complete the entire project is $5,000 and the agency is accepting donations to defray the remaining expense.
Since 1975, Center For Siouxland has been providing comprehensive human services to the residents of our region, including: Consumer Credit Counseling, Client Trust, Retired and Senior Volunteer Program, and Community Assistance which includes a pantry, transitional housing for the homeless, prescription assistance, utility assistance and a 2-1-1 information and referral helpline.
